
Camp America
Content Creator Lead
As Content Creator Lead at Camp America, I was responsible for driving content creation and managing social media across multiple platforms. I developed new brand guidelines and promotional materials, designed and launched a new website, and led comprehensive marketing campaigns. Additionally, I produced and featured in a documentary about camp life, overseeing its creative direction, marketing, and premiere. My role also involved recruitment efforts, managing influencer partnerships, and hosting a podcast, demonstrating a broad range of marketing and leadership skills.

Social Media channels
Throughout my time as Content Creator lead I grew our Tiktok account from 40k followers to 82.1k followers in a 8 months reaching 1.4 million views.
​
I monitored trends ensuring that our content stayed relevant and creating engaging, information content using both Premiere Pro and Capcut.
​
I also manage the Instagram account which has continued to grow and have a high engagement rate. I create, edit and post the content ensuring all is on brand and appealing to our audience.
​
As well as managing the social media platforms I have also formed and nurtured our Content Creator network, building it scratch.

Documentary Production
I played a pivotal role in the creation of a documentary that showcased the experience of working at a summer camp. I not only featured in the documentary but also contributed significantly to its creative direction, ensuring the narrative aligned with the brand’s mission and vision. I was responsible for running the marketing strategy for the documentary, including creating and executing social media campaigns, email marketing, and paid advertisements to maximize its reach.
I planned, promoted and hosted the premiere of the documentary which was held at Electric Cinema in Notting Hill.
